Greeks of the Homeric Catalogue of Ships

Trojan War

The Phocians participated in the Trojan War with 40 ships (Il. 2.524) under the leadership of Schedius and Epistrophus (Il. 2.517). Phocian cities listed in the Homeric Catalogue of Ships: 1. Cyparissus, 2. Pytho, 3. Crisa, 4. Daulis, 5. Panopeus, 6. Anemoreia, 7. Hyampolis, 8. Lilaea.

Greek heroes of the Trojan War

Schedius, son of Perimedes

Schedius, son of Perimedes, a leader of the Phocians, was slain by Hector (Il. 15.515).

Actor

Father of Menoetius and grandfather of Patroclus (Il. 11.785).

Actor (Aktor). A son of Deion and Diomede, the daughter of Xuthus. He was thus a brother of Asteropeia, Acnetus, Phylacus, and Cephalus, and husband of Aegina, father of Menoetius, and grandfather of Patroclus. (Apollod. i. 9.4, 16, iii. 10.8; Pind. Ol. ix. 75; Hom. Il. xi. 785, xvi. 14)

Perimedes

The father of Schedius (Il. 15.515).
